Edinburgh’s blend of medieval and Georgian architecture gives it an enchanting allure.
The historic Royal Mile, connecting Edinburgh Castle to the Palace of Holyroodhouse, is adorned with charming buildings and hidden closes. The atmospheric Old Town, with its narrow alleyways and historic pubs, contrasts with the elegant Georgian New Town, forming a city of remarkable beauty.
